WITH the effects of Storm Doris at the back-end of the week, followed by more heavy rain on Friday night, not a single game survived in the Furness and South Cumbria area, writes Steve Brennan.

Three local teams did manage to get a game in on the road, with Crooklands Casuals managing a 1-1 draw in their West Lancs Premier Division clash on the 3G surface at Whitehaven.

Casuals came from a goal behind to draw 1-1, with Dave Mansergh bagging his 15th league goal.

In the First Division Hawcoat also played on a 3G surface at Ladybridge, but they were undone by an 84th-minute goal and slipped to another away defeat.

Hawcoat now have to re-focus as they have a semi-final to look forward to this weekend as they face Poulton in the Presidents Cup.

Askam made the short trip to Milnthorpe and were beaten 3-0.
